About

Priya covers the technology side of TaxScout's editorial: how AI extraction actually works (and where it fails), what tax-tech vendor sales pitches conveniently leave out, and what a modern CPA software stack looks like when you size it for the firm you're trying to build rather than the firm you have.

She writes for the partner who is being asked 'should we switch to platform X?' and needs an honest answer that doesn't come from the vendor's sales team. Her vendor comparisons cite each platform's public pricing as of the post's date, surface the operational differences that actually matter day-two, and stay transparent about TaxScout's own positioning — including where TaxScout isn't the right fit.

Priya's categories: feature deep-dives, software comparisons, AI implementation, vendor evaluation. When you see her byline on a comparison post, every claim has been cross-checked against the competitor's public docs and pricing within 60 days of publication.

Editorial standards

Every article on TaxScout, regardless of byline, follows the same evidentiary standards. The byline reflects topical authority — who on our editorial team is responsible for the category — not single-author writing.

  • Primary sources only

    Tax law and IRS form claims link to IRS.gov, Treasury, state revenue agencies, Cornell LII, or the AICPA — never third-party summaries.

  • Numbers we can verify

    Product claims come from our codebase; competitor pricing comes from each vendor's public pricing page and is dated when cited.

  • Updated, not abandoned

    Articles touching tax-year-specific guidance carry a visible "Updated" date and `dateModified` Schema.org property when revised.
